Output 6312c3b71af8090a889597e27c79d8080ea318109802e309d9a67e9578205693:0

value
12521466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53cb230c6e0015d045ddd6bba087010e4978ed4f OP_EQUAL
address
39L5MfZ3MeNSxCMkmq9LU3fg1JcgC25tSL
transaction
6312c3b71af8090a889597e27c79d8080ea318109802e309d9a67e9578205693